pigne
French
Etymology
Borrowed from Occitan pinha, from Latin pīnea.
Pronunciation
Noun
pigne f (plural pignes)
- (botany, Meridional) synonym of pomme de pin (“pinecone”)
- (botany) synonym of pignon (“pine nut”)
